K8s认证备考:海外VPS部署环境全流程指南
文章分类:售后支持 /
创建时间:2025-12-02
K8s(Kubernetes,容器编排系统)认证考试注重实操能力,稳定的集群环境是备考关键。海外VPS因网络覆盖广、资源弹性高的特点,能为考生提供接近真实考试场景的部署环境。本文结合备考需求,从VPS选型到模拟练习,梳理一套可落地的实操指南。
海外VPS核心参数选择与基础配置
选择海外VPS时,需重点关注三方面参数:计算资源、存储性能与网络质量。K8s集群对资源有基础要求——至少2核CPU、4GB内存(控制平面组件etcd、kube-apiserver需占用约1.5GB内存)、20GB SSD存储(SSD可提升容器镜像拉取与日志读写速度)。网络方面,建议选择带宽≥100Mbps、延迟低于150ms的节点,避免因网络波动影响集群组件通信。
选定VPS后,需完成基础系统配置。通过SSH连接实例,首先更新系统包:`apt update && apt upgrade -y`(以Ubuntu系统为例)。接着安装Docker(K8s默认容器运行时),执行`sudo apt install docker.io -y`,并设置开机自启:`systemctl enable --now docker`。最后关闭交换分区(K8s要求禁用Swap):`swapoff -a && sed -i '/ swap / s/^/#/' /etc/fstab`。
K8s集群部署与考试资源准备
备考场景推荐使用minikube工具快速搭建单节点集群。相比kubeadm,minikube操作更简单,适合练习基础命令(如kubectl)。部署步骤如下:
1. 下载minikube二进制文件:`curl -LO https://storage.googleapis.com/minikube/releases/latest/minikube-linux-amd64`
2. 安装并授权:`sudo install minikube-linux-amd64 /usr/local/bin/minikube`
3. 启动集群(指定资源避免性能不足):`minikube start --cpus=2 --memory=4096 --disk-size=20g`
集群启动后,需同步考试所需资源。K8s认证(如CKA)常考察Deployment、Service、ConfigMap等资源操作,可从官方文档下载示例YAML文件(如nginx-deployment.yaml),通过`kubectl apply -f`命令部署到集群中。建议额外部署metrics-server(用于资源监控练习):`minikube addons enable metrics-server`。
模拟考试与故障处理实战
模拟考试是检验备考效果的关键环节。可使用官方提供的练习平台(如Killer.sh),按考试时长(通常3小时)完成20-25道实操题。练习时需注意:
- 熟悉kubectl常用命令(如`kubectl get pods -o wide`查看Pod节点分布)
- 掌握日志排查(`kubectl logs
- 练习资源配额设置(如限制容器CPU/内存)与自动扩缩容(Horizontal Pod Autoscaler)
备考中难免遇到集群故障,常见问题及解决方法:
- Pod状态为Pending:可能是资源不足(检查`kubectl describe node`查看资源使用)或镜像拉取失败(检查镜像名称是否正确,或配置私有镜像仓库认证)。
- 服务无法访问:确认Service类型(ClusterIP需配合Ingress,NodePort需开放对应端口),检查防火墙规则是否放行节点端口。
通过海外VPS搭建K8s环境,结合系统的模拟练习与故障处理,能有效提升实操熟练度。备考时保持每日1-2小时实操训练,重点突破存储卷(PV/PVC)、网络策略(NetworkPolicy)等高频考点,K8s认证考试通关将更有把握。
上一篇: CentOS海外VPS合规认证全流程指南
下一篇: 国外VPS在网站架构中的运行原理详解
工信部备案:苏ICP备2025168537号-1